Media and Power in International ContextsPerspectives on Agency and Identity\nAuthor(s): Apryl Williams, Ruth Tsuria, Laura Robinson\nFormat: Hardback\nPublisher: Emerald Publishing Limited, United Kingdom\nImprint: Emerald Publishing Limited\nISBN-13: 9781787694569, 978-1787694569\nSynopsis\nThis special volume of Emerald Studies in Media and Communications is entitled Media and Power in International Contexts: Perspectives on Agency and Identity. Scholars of communication, media studies, sociology, and cultural studies come together to examine axioms of power at play across different forms of cultural production.
